Age

The typewriter I use
Has become a sideshow.
Which reminds me,

This past birthday I 
Found only one
Card in my mailbox

(That's the metal thing

Which hangs by the doorbell,
Collecting coupons).

I try to explain my old job in
"Paste-up" to a friend a smidge
Younger. She nod-smiles.

Excuse me.

I have to go look for the
Emoticon
For throwing up my hands.
